打开网易新闻 查看精彩图片

Claude Code 的源码最近被放出来了,51万行。这不是什么"致敬开源"的情怀动作,Anthropic 想让你看的,是一家 AI 公司怎么把大模型塞进真实的工作流

很多人以为企业级 AI 拼的是模型参数,是算力堆出来的聪明劲儿。但读代码就像翻一家餐厅的账本——菜单上的招牌菜反而没那么重要,后厨怎么备货、怎么协调火候、怎么应对突然的团餐订单,这些才是活下去的底子。

Claude Code 的底子长什么样?

第一,它把"工具调用"做成了肌肉记忆。不是让用户去记指令,而是让模型自己判断什么时候该查文件、什么时候该跑测试。这有点像自动挡和手动挡的区别——老司机可能觉得少了操控感,但企业要的是降低培训成本,让新人也能上路。

第二,权限管理嵌在每一行交互里。代码里能看到大量的上下文边界检查,模型能碰什么、不能碰什么,不是事后提醒,是事前拦截。企业最怕的不是 AI 不够聪明,是聪明过了头,把不该看的数据看了,把不该改的配置改了。

第三,也是最容易被忽略的:日志和反馈回路。Claude Code 记录了每一次用户干预——你纠正了它的哪个判断、手动覆盖了哪个操作。这些数据不会直接喂给模型,但会沉淀成产品迭代的坐标。换句话说,这不是一个"部署完就完事"的工具,它是一个持续学习的组织接口。

51万行代码里,真正关于模型推理的部分可能不到十分之一。剩下的都是在处理"人"的问题:怎么让人愿意用、敢用、用得顺手。Anthropic 开源的不是技术秘密,是一种务实的态度——AI 落地,代码只是冰山一角,水下的部分才是撞船的风险。

有个细节挺有意思:源码里大量注释写的不是"这段代码做什么",而是"我们为什么没选另一条路"。这种自我辩解式的文档,通常是内部争论留下的痕迹。看来即便是 Anthropic,做企业级产品也免不了反复拉扯。